Job Description- Maintain and enhance existing data processes, ensuring reliability, performance, and scalability
- Improve and support Python-based services and contribute to the development of new ones
- Design, implement, and optimize scalable data architecture
- Drive system reliability and performance improvements across all data workflows
- Oversee and execute data process modernization, including the introduction of new tools and technologies
- Manage data flow between local storage, AWS, and Snowflake to ensure performance and cost efficiency
- Lead and support the migration of data pipelines and services to Snowflake
- Work with and improve the data orchestration layer (Airflow), ensuring stable operation, scalability, and alignment with future platform needs
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ure architectural alignment and best practices adoption
- 5+ year proficiency in Python for data processing and platform development
- Advanced knowledge of SQL and the ability to write efficient and complex queries
- Strong hands-on experience with Snowflake
- Proficiency in DBT for data transformation and modeling
- Practical experience working with Airflow to orchestrate of data workflows
- Upper-Intermediate level of English
